Les clients qui ont acheté ce produit ont également acheté...
- Arduino Uno - DIP Rev3
- Capteur de luminosite haute precision - TSL2591
- FeatherWing Doubler Proto pour carte Feather
- Capteur de distance ultrason HC-SR04
- Mini Camera Espion avec trigger pour photo et video
- Bague RFID NFC - Taille 10 - NTAG213
- Tag RFID Mifare 13.56MHz
- Adafruit Ultimate GPS FeatherWing
- Bande de LED NeoPixel 30 LED RGB avec connecteur JST - 0,5m
En savoir plus
Description
Un nouveau microphone exotique est arrivé dans la boutique, un micro MEMS PDM! Le PDM est le 'troisième' type de microphone que vous pouvez intégrer avec l'électronique, à part analogique ou I2S. Ces microphones sont très couramment utilisés dans les produits, mais sont rarement vus dans les projets des fabricants. Ils ont quand même des avantages, alors nous avons pensé à l'intégrer dans le magasin.
La première chose à noter est que ce capteur ne fournit pas une sortie "analogique" comme beaucoup de nos microphone électret. Il est donc idéal pour les microcontrôleur qui n'ont pas d'entrées analogiques. Deuxièmement, l'interface numérique est une sortie de modulation de densité d'impulsions très simpliste. C'est numérique mais ce n'est pas PWM et ce n'est pas I2S. Vous devrez vous assurer que votre puce dispose d'une interface PDM - la plupart des processeurs 32 bits de nos jours en ont une!
PDM est un peu comme un PWM 1-bit. Vous chronométrez le micro avec une fréquence d'horloge de 1 MHz - 3 MHz, et sur la ligne de données vous obtiendrez une onde carrée qui se synchronise avec l'horloge. La ligne de données avec sortie logique 0 ou 1, avec l'onde carrée créant une densité qui, une fois la moyenne calculée, donnera la valeur analogique.
Il y a plusieurs façons de gérer ces micros:
- Votre micro-contrôleur est livrée avec un périphérique matériel et une librairie qui gère toutes les données à grande vitesse, collecte des échantillons, applique un filtre et vous donne une valeur analogique (Idéal!)
- Votre micro-contrôleur est livrée avec un périphérique matériel qui vous donne des valeurs, puis c'est à vous d'effectuer la décimation/filtration. (Nous avons quelques exemples de code pour cela sur le chipset ATSAMD21)
- Votre micro-contrôleur n'est pas livrée avec un périphérique matériel mais vous êtes plutôt malin et trouvez un moyen de le faire fonctionner (voir cet exemple pour l'ATtiny85)
- Vous générez l'horloge haute vitesse, puis ajoutez un filtre analogique sur la ligne de données, et lisez la valeur analogique (un hack, mais fonctionne!)
Quelle que soit la façon dont vous décidez d' y aller, assurez-vous d'avoir une idée du support que vous obtenez avec votre plateforme, car ces puces sont un peu délicates!
Chaque commande est livrée avec un microphone entièrement assemblé et testé, ainsi qu'un petit connecteur à souder pour une compatibilité avec breadboard.
Caractéristiques
- Gamme de tension: 1,8-3,3V
- Fréquence d'horloge: 1 - 3,25 MHz
- Consommation de courant: 0,6mA
- SNR: 61 dB
- Sensibilité: ~-26 dBFS
- Dimensions du produit: 14,0 mm x 12,8 mm x 2,8 mm / 0,6 po x 0,5 po x 0,1 po
- Poids du produit: 0.5g / 0.0oz
Documentation
Accessoires
- 5,94 € Ajouter au panier
- 1,14 € Ajouter au panier
- 8,34 € Ajouter au panier
Ampli audio classe D Mono 2,5W - PAM8302
Un petit ampli à base de PAM8302 pour donner de la puissance à vos montages audio.
4,74 € Ajouter au panierAmpli Audio Stereo 2.1W Class D - TPA2012
Un amplificateur audio stéréo 2.1W Class D à base de TPA2012.
11,94 € Ajouter au panier